The temperature ranged from 7.4°C around 00:00 to 15.2°C around 18:00. Rain was recorded across 10 hours, from around 00:00 to 15:00 (10.6mm total).

Data type
Reanalysis — a physically consistent reconstruction combining a forecast model with historical observations, not a live station reading or a forecast
